Combatting that Rise of ID Fraud: Strategies for a Secure Future

In today's increasingly digital landscape, identity theft poses a significant threat to individuals and organizations alike. With sophisticated cybercriminals constantly evolving their tactics, combating the rise of ID fraud requires a multi-faceted approach. Stringent security measures are essential to protect sensitive personal information. Implementing strong authentication protocols, such as multi-factor authorization, can help prevent unauthorized access to accounts. Additionally, raising public consciousness about the dangers of ID fraud is paramount. Individuals should be equipped with the knowledge and tools to safeguard their identities. Promoting data security best practices, including using strong passwords and being cautious concerning phishing scams, can reduce the risk of becoming a victim.

  • Moreover, collaboration between government agencies, financial institutions, and technology companies is critical to effectively combat ID fraud.
  • Sharing information about emerging threats and adopting industry-wide security standards can strengthen the overall defense against cybercriminals.

By implementing these strategies, we can work towards a more secure future where individuals' identities are protected from detrimental exploitation.

Strengthening Digital Defenses with Biometric Authentication

In our increasingly digital world, safeguarding digital assets has become paramount. Traditional authentication methods, such as passwords and PINs, are increasingly vulnerable to malicious intrusions. Biometric security emerges as a robust solution, leveraging unique biographical traits to verify identities and mitigate the risk of unauthorized access. By employing technologies like fingerprint scanning, facial recognition, or iris verification, biometric systems provide a higher level of security. These methods are inherently difficult to imitate, making it significantly harder for criminals to compromise accounts and compromise sensitive information.

Biometric security offers strengths that extend beyond enhanced defense. Simplified authentication processes eliminate the need for users to remember complex passwords, reducing hassle. Moreover, biometric systems can automatically verify identities, expediting access to applications and services.

  • Furthermore, biometric security is continuously evolving with advancements in machine learning and artificial intelligence, further strengthening its ability to recognize suspicious activities.
  • Despite these benefits, it's crucial to address potential challenges associated with biometric data, such as privacy violations and the potential for exploitation.
  • Thus, implementing robust security measures, such as secure storage, is essential to mitigate these risks and ensure the responsible use of biometric technology.
